Brazilian President Bolsonaro in quarantine

Brazilian President Zaire Bolsonaro left for quarantine on Wednesday.

Bolsonaro made the decision after Brazilian Health Minister Marcelo Cuiroga, who attended the UN General Assembly, fell victim to Corona. News Anadolu.

In the wake of the health minister’s coronation, the country’s health authorities have requested the Brazilian Health Authority Agency (ANVISA) to isolate Zaire Bolsonaro and those who accompanied him to the UN General Assembly.

A statement from Brazil’s presidential palace said all members of the delegation would remain in quarantine for five days.

On Tuesday, the day before his return from the United States, Brazil’s health minister was coronated. He then had to go to a quarantine at a hotel in New York.

Earlier, another member of the Brazilian delegation was killed by Corona.
